\(\normalsize\color{darkgreen}{ \rm \sqrt{2x+8}-6=4 }\) like this ?

OpenStudy (anonymous):

Yeah

OpenStudy (solomonzelman):

\(\normalsize\color{darkgreen}{ \rm \sqrt{2x+8}-6=4 }\) \(\normalsize\color{darkgreen}{ \rm \sqrt{2x+8}-6\color{blue}{+6}=4 \color{blue}{+6} }\) \(\normalsize\color{darkgreen}{ \rm \sqrt{2x+8}=10 }\) \(\normalsize\color{darkgreen}{ \rm 2x+8=100 }\) \(\normalsize\color{darkgreen}{ \rm 2x+8\color{blue}{-8}=100 \color{blue}{-8} }\) \(\normalsize\color{darkgreen}{ \rm 2x=92 }\) \(\normalsize\color{darkgreen}{ \rm x=46 }\) RIGHT
